Output e31bb3e69ea10a5bb84c6d6f8a470add30f912f720943f3eb7b89140c1fd8ee5:0

value
5634977
script pubkey
OP_0 OP_PUSHBYTES_20 de5116d238c20b5bdcd8962f3ef5856434768da6
address
bc1qmeg3d53ccg94hhxcjchnaav9vs68drdx9ej4fu
transaction
e31bb3e69ea10a5bb84c6d6f8a470add30f912f720943f3eb7b89140c1fd8ee5
confirmations
86410
spent
true